This little burger stand in Templeton is worth a stop and try. As a local, I 've tried a few of their menu items. While they promote their burgers, the burger isn 't what keeps me coming back. My go to menu item is their grilled chicken sandwich. It 's also available with crispy chicken tenders, but the grilled chicken breast is my favorite. Their crinkle cut fries are a perfect compliment and the regular size is a generous portion. Get the large if you 're sharing. We prefer to order them extra crispy that 's the best! They also have some specialty beverages. Their original Templeton Tea isn 't bad, but my favorite is their soda freeze! Made with any of their fountain soda flavors and real vanilla ice cream (not fast food soft serve), it provides all the sweetness and slushiness of a float that 's already mixed together. They also have online ordering to make getting your food fresh, hot, and fast much more convenient. *FYI: Their menu is on the pricier side, but we appreciate quality, especially when it comes to chicken.
